Castle Fight Perks Edition vs The Super Summoner

Castle Fight Perks Edition is the more popular of the two, with 9,226 recorded sessions versus 15. Castle Fight Perks Edition averages more players per lobby (5 vs 2.3), suggesting larger games. Castle Fight Perks Edition lobbies fill faster, sitting open 2.2 min on average versus 13.6 min for The Super Summoner. Over the past 30 days, Castle Fight Perks Edition has seen more activity.
